What the numbers show

Manure Management — Emissions (CO2eq) (AR5) — UNFCCC is currently reported for 79 countries. The highest value is 21,820 kt in Brazil; the lowest is 0.7 kt in Palau.

The median across all reporting countries is 739.41 kt, and the mean is 2,444 kt.

The gap between the highest and lowest reporting country is a factor of about 31,171.

Over the past decade 45 countries rose and 33 fell. The largest increase was in Belize (up 3,437.7%), and the largest decrease in Myanmar (down 95.6%).

The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ions Totals summarizes the gre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ions disseminated in the FAOSTAT Climate Change domains of emissions from agrifood systems. Data are computed following the Tier 1 methods of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) Guidelines for National greenhouse gas (GHG) Inventories (IPCC, 1996; 1997; 2000; 2002; 2006; 2014). Emissions from other economic sectors as defined by the IPCC are also disseminated in the domain for completeness.
